The Benefits of Casinos

Casinos are establishments for gambling and may be located in or combined with hotels, restaurants, retail shops, cruise ships, or other tourist attractions. They are often themed and offer a variety of games, including poker, blackjack, roulette, and video slots. They also feature entertainment such as concerts and comedy shows. In addition, they may provide services such as spas and salons.

Despite the seedy stereotype of backroom gambling parlors, most casinos are clean and well-organized. They employ security guards to patrol their parking lots and watch over the activities of their patrons. Crime still happens, but it is rare and is usually confined to areas outside the casino. Casinos are an important economic factor in many towns and cities, bringing in tourists and generating taxes. They also support local businesses and charities.
